Job Description
The Job

The Associate BIT Post Production Engineer will provide tier 2 support for media creation stations as part of CNN's digital production workflow, including post production and advanced computer graphics activities. You will collaborate with the tier 2 and tier 3 team members to help support, implement and document systems and workflows for the Post Technology Infrastructure. You will also participate on project implementation.

The Daily

The Associate Broadcast & IT Systems Engineer requires a solid understanding of technology and practices necessary to perform maintenance and installation in a fast-paced production environment.

A working knowledge of IT and data networking is also necessary to work in an increasingly IP and IT centric broadcast/multimedia infrastructure.

Collaboration with team members, clients and other support groups is required to troubleshoot and resolve issues with broadcast/multimedia systems and computers in our production environments.

Turner BEST teams operate within an ITSM Service Management framework, supported by common processes around planning and managing changes. Adherence to our standard ITSM processes to minimize impact and deliver value to our customers is required. This includes documenting issues/requests and escalating as needed for problem management and resolution via our in house service management system(s).

A willingness to perform varied tasks, document systems and processes, adapt to changing priorities, and the ability to solve technical problems are essential to be successful in this position. We expect our Associate BIT engineers to build good relationships amongst our client base and to provide excellent customer service. Good communication skills (verbal and written) are required.

Shift work on a rotating schedule is necessary to meet the needs of our customers.

In this role, you will be responsible for providing first class support to our partners across the broadcast and post production facilities including evening live event coverage, after hours on-call support and occasional travels.

The Essentials
• Provide hands-on technical support and resolution to all incidents and tasks for CNN News, Digital, Sports, and Graphics systems and workflows including all attached peripherals and applications.
• Assist with project tasks under the direction of a more senior engineer.
• Review tickets for accurate resolution notes, adding or updating information as needed.
• Create knowledge articles in ServiceNow for Tier 1 reference
• Effective collaboration with team members.
• Effective communication with partners for feedback, updates and information gathering.
• Participate in or provide peer training on systems and workflows.
• Deploy standard patches and upgrades. Assist in performing system maintenance and deployments.
• Training on technologies our team supports and implements in order to provide the best possible support for our customers and to assist with projects as needed.
• Willingness to understand and learn our users workflows to the extent needed for technical troubleshooting

Qualifications:
•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Computer Science or a related discipline;
• 3+ years of experience in a Broadcast, IT or similar environment.
• Some knowledge and troubleshooting skills of Adobe products primarily in Adobe Premiere and After Effects, and other applications including Viz, Resolve, and Cinema4D.
• Experience supporting Mac and Windows environments, including software deployment tools such as JAMF or LANDesk.
• Experience with file-based workflows, compression methods and understanding of Media and Project asset management concepts and architecture are a big plus but not a requirement.
• Skills in systems and storage configuration and administration with SAN, NAS, Gateways and Archive technologies. Particularly in Quantum StorNext File System, Opendrives, Quantum DLC, Microsoft and Linux gateways, and render farms are a plus but not a requirement.
• Strong understanding of Post Production technical workflows.
• Excellent communication skills are a must.
